Webb17 maj 2024 · A shared/split Evaluation and Management (E/M) visit is defined as a medically necessary encounter with a patient in the facility setting performed in part by both a physician and a Non-Physician Practitioner (NPP) each with the same patient on the same date of service.
WebbSplit (or shared) Critical Care Services: Critical care visits may be furnished as split (or shared) visit. When critical care services are furnished as a split (or shared) visit, the substantive portion is defined as more than half the cumulative total time in qualifying activities that are included in CPT codes 99291 and 99292. WebbA shared or split visit is defined as any visit in which a physician and/or other qualified healthcare professional jointly perform face-to-face and non-face-to-face work related to the visit. It is important to understand that only distinct time should be summed for shared/split visits.
Webb2 dec. 2024 · An organization might bill split/shared visits because it allows 100% reimbursement of the physician fee. If billed under the NPI of the PA, reimbursement will be at 85% of the physician fee. For this type of service to be billed, the PA and supervising physician must be employed by the same organization. Webb9 dec. 2024 · For 2024, the substantive portion of a split (or shared) E/M visit can be determined based on one of two methods: more than half of the total time spent OR. one of the three key components (history, exam, or medical decision making [MDM]). When one of the three key components is used, the practitioner who bills the visit must perform that ...
